Direct Visualization, Sizing and Counting of Extracellular Vesicles Using NTA
10 Mar 2014Much interest centers on microvesicles and nanovesicles (exosomes) as they are increasingly cited as potential biomarkers. This application note demonstrates that Nanoparticle Tracking Analysis NTA can size and count both microvesicles and exosomes at a low concentration and can selectively determine and analyze specific types of particle within a complex sample.

An assay system is required for identification of biomarkers. :Particle CharacterizationParticle characterization instruments are used to determine particle size distribution, shape, surface area, zeta potential, density and porosity of particles and materials. Multiple tecchniques are available for determining particle size, shape and count including dynamic light scattering (DLS), laser diffraction, electrozone (Coulter technique), imaging particle analysis and single particle optical sensing. Determine the density of your material with a gas pycnometer or examine its surface area and porosity with gas adsorption analyzers and mercury porosimeters.
